On One Studios

422 N. Capitol Ave., San Jose - East Valley / 680

<b>Photo: On One Studios/<a href="https://www.yelp.com/biz_photos/on-one-studios-san-jose?utm_campaign=9a356763-b2c8-44ea-a47e-3f4185965129%2C59a5d682-8be1-4c4e-9328-5eb2547e688c&utm_medium=81024472-a80c-4266-a0e5-a3bf8775daa7"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ank" data-ylk="slk:Yelp;elm:context_link;itc:0;sec:content-canvas" class="link ">Yelp</a></b>

On One Studios is San Jose's favorite dance studio by the numbers, with 4.8 stars out of 213 reviews on ClassPass, five stars out of 20 reviews on Yelp and 4,382 fans on Facebook. It's the top dance studio in the entire San Jose metro area, according to ClassPass' rankings.

"On One Studios (OOS) is a dance studio dedicated to spreading the passion, creativity and joy that comes with dance," per the business's profile on ClassPass. "Their mission is to spread the positive benefits that dance brings to the greater community. Their workshops and classes are open to people of all ages and skill levels."

"We are a student-first studio with over seven years of experience hosting workshops and events in the Bay Area," its Yelp page states. "We only hire instructors who are invested in the growth of their students, experienced in teaching — not simply dancing — and passionate about the art form of dance and its progression as a living language. You will not find instructors simply teaching choreography at our studio, but rather you will find mentors who are compassionate, thoughtful and student-first."

Dance Boulevard

1824 Hillsdale Ave., Cambrian Park

<b>Photo: Dance Boulevard/<a href="https://www.yelp.com/biz_photos/dance-boulevard-san-jose-2?utm_campaign=9a356763-b2c8-44ea-a47e-3f4185965129%2C59a5d682-8be1-4c4e-9328-5eb2547e688c&utm_medium=81024472-a80c-4266-a0e5-a3bf8775daa7"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ank" data-ylk="slk:Yelp;elm:context_link;itc:0;sec:content-canvas" class="link ">Yelp</a></b>

With 4.4 stars out of 31 reviews on ClassPass, 4.5 stars out of 59 reviews on Yelp and 1,856 fans on Facebook, Dance Boulevard is another popular local pick.

"Dance Boulevard was opened in 1996 as a small two teacher project," Dance Boulevard's Yelp page states. "As the years have passed everything has grown from two teachers to over 30, from 1500 square feet to over 10,000, from 10 initial students to over 17,000 customers our dance studio keeps getting bigger and better. Please come try us out for any of your dancing interests."

"Everyone and all levels are welcome," states the business's profile on ClassPass.
